IM钱包对接API有哪些基本功能和优势?

在进行IM钱包对接API之前,了解其基本功能和优势十分重要。IM钱包对接API提供了以下基本功能:
1. 提供支付接口:IM钱包对接API允许用户进行在线支付,可以接受不同的支付方式,如信用卡、银行转账等,提供便捷的支付体验。
2. 资金管理:IM钱包对接API提供了丰富的资金管理功能,用户可以方便地进行账户余额查询、充值、提现等操作,实现灵活的资金管理。
3. 订单管理:IM钱包对接API允许用户管理支付订单,包括查询订单状态、取消订单等,确保支付过程的安全和可靠性。
IM钱包对接API的优势包括:
1. 简单快捷:IM钱包对接API具有简单易用的特点,对接过程简洁高效,可以快速集成到现有的支付系统中,降低开发与维护成本。
2. 安全可靠:IM钱包对接API采用高级的加密技术和风控系统,确保支付过程的安全性,保护用户的资金信息不被泄露。
3. 多样支付方式:IM钱包对接API支持多种支付方式,满足用户的不同需求,提供了更多选择。

如何进行IM钱包对接API?

要进行IM钱包对接API,需要以下步骤:
1. 注册IM钱包商户账号:首先,前往IM钱包官方网站,根据指引注册一个商户账号,获取商户ID和安全密钥作为对接API的凭证。
2. API文档查阅:IM钱包官方提供了详细的API文档,开发者可以仔细阅读文档,了解API的具体接口和参数,为对接做好准备。
3. 开发与集成:根据API文档的要求,在现有的支付系统中加入对IM钱包API的调用,包括支付接口和资金管理接口。开发者可以使用相应的编程语言和开发工具进行开发和测试。
4. 测试与调试:完成对接开发后,需要进行严格的测试与调试工作,确保API接口的正常运行和数据的准确性。
5. 上线与发布:对接完成后,上线前进行全面测试,确保系统的稳定性和安全性。如果一切正常,就可以正式发布IM钱包支付功能。

如何确保IM钱包对接API的安全性?

对接API涉及到支付和资金管理,安全性非常重要。以下是确保IM钱包对接API安全性的几个关键点:
1. 使用HTTPS协议:对于敏感数据的传输,需要使用HTTPS协议进行加密,防止数据在传输过程中被窃取。
2. 身份验证和签名验证:IM钱包对接API中通常包含身份验证和签名验证的机制,确保请求的合法性和完整性。
3. 风险控制系统:IM钱包对接API会提供一些风险控制手段,如IP黑名单、交易限额等,以防范潜在的安全威胁和欺诈行为。
4. 定期更新API版本:IM钱包会定期发布更新的API版本,修复已知的安全漏洞和问题,开发者需要及时更新API版本以保证安全。

如何处理常见的对接API错误和异常情况?

在对接API的过程中,可能会遇到一些错误和异常情况。以下是一些常见问题的解决方法:
1. 接口调用错误:在对接API过程中,可能会因为传参错误、参数格式不正确等导致接口调用失败。开发者需要仔细检查参数的正确性,查看API文档中的错误码和错误信息,以便定位和解决问题。
2. 异常情况处理:在支付过程中,用户可能会取消支付、网络异常等情况发生。开发者需要在代码中处理这些异常情况,给予用户相应的提示,并记录日志以便排查问题。
3. 交易状态查询:在使用IM钱包对接API时,可能需要查询交易的状态。开发者可以使用相应的接口来查询订单状态,并根据不同的状态进行相应的处理和通知。

如何IM钱包对接API的性能和用户体验?

为了提升IM钱包对接API的性能和用户体验,可以考虑以下几个方面:
1. 异步通知:使用异步通知机制可以提高支付过程的效率,减少用户等待时间,增强用户体验。
2. 支付结果页面设计:在支付成功或失败后跳转的页面中,设计的提示信息,帮助用户快速了解支付结果,减少用户的困惑和误解。
3. 支付流程:对于复杂的支付流程,可以页面设计和交互方式,简化用户操作,提高支付的顺畅度。
4. 缓存机制:对于频繁查询的数据,可以使用缓存机制,减少对数据库的访问,提高API的响应速度。
5. 异常处理与系统监控:建立完善的异常处理机制,及时监控API的运行情况,并记录错误日志以便排查问题,保障系统的稳定性和可靠性。

以上是关于IM钱包对接API的详细介绍,包括基本功能、对接步骤、安全性、常见错误处理和性能。通过对接API,可以实现高效的支付和资金管理,提升用户的支付体验和满意度。